  The long story is it depends on your technical
requirements, budget, capabilities, etc.

  The short story is for quick, free 15 meter Landsat
mosaics (in MrSID format) go to NASA's Geocover site:
https://zulu.ssc.nasa.gov/mrsid/.  There are other sources
of Landsat data, but they take some image processing get a
nice geo-referenced seamless RGB mosaic of images.
